✒️La creación de un IDoc en SAP
La creación de un IDoc en SAP
Los pasos para la creación de un IDOC: para desarrollar un IDOC desde ceso se deben seguir necesariamente la mayoría de los siguiente pasos:
- Crear los segmentos, el tipo de bese y el tipo de mensaje.
- Asignar el tipo de base al tipo de mensaje.
- Asignar el tipo de mensaje al objeto de aplicación.
- Programar los módulos de función de actualización o generación de IDOCS (de entrada o salida).
- Definir los códigos de proceso y asignar los módulos de función generados.
- Actualizar el modelo de distribución y el acuerdo de interlocutores.
- Visualizar la Documentación de IDOCS.
Los pasos para creación de los segmentos son:
- Ejecutamos la transacción WE31, ingresamos el nombre del tipo de segmento, el cual debe comenzar con Z1 y presionamos el botón Crear.
- El sistema nos advertirá que el nombre adjudicado tiene más de 7 caracteres, a lo que nosotros presionamos el botón Continuar.
- Introducimos una descripción breve para el segmento, los nombres de los campos, tipo de datos de los campos del segmento y tildamos la opción Segmento calificado.
- Luego presionamos el botón Grabar y el sistema asignara la Persona responsable y la Persona que procesa el segmento en forma automática.
- A continuación el sistema asignara automáticamente un nombre a la definición del segmento, basado en el nombre del tipo de segmento.
- Al terminar la edición del segmento, se debe liberar.
- Al liberar, se establece la versión utilizable del segmento.
El tipo de base de un IDOC define la estructura de un mensaje. Ello incluye:
- Los segmentos que contendrá el mensaje.
- El orden entre los segmentos.
- La jerarquía entro los segmentos.
- Las repeticiones.
Los pasos para la creación del tipo base del IDOC son:
- Ejecutamos la transacción WE30, ingresamos el nombre del tipo base de IDOC, que debe comenzar con Z, seleccionamos la opción Tipo Base y presionamos el botón Crear.
- El sistema nos advierte que el nombre adjudicado tiene tiene más de 8 caracteres, a lo que nosotros presionamos el botón continuar.
- En la siguiente pantalla, seleccionamos la opción Crear nuevo, ingresamos una descripción para el tipo de base de IDOC y presionamos el botón continuar.
- Luego presionamos el puntero del mouse sobre el nombre del IDOC y presionamos el botón Crear.
- Ingresamos a continuación el tipo de segmento, sus atributos y presionamos Continuar.
- Al presionar continuar, el sistema transfiere el nombre de tipo de segmento al editor del IDOC.
- Finalmente guardamos el tipo base de IDOC.
Es importante tener en cuenta que mediante esta misma transacción se pueden crear extensiones de tipo base estándar. Para ello, en la pantalla inicial, se debe seleccionar "AMPLIACIÓN".
El sistema nos pedirá el tipo de base original y luego, se podrán agregar nuevos segmentos.
Las extensiones no modifican el tipo de base original, sino que agregan un link a un tipo base Z, que depende del original. Para utilizar las extensiones, es necesario informar además, el tipo base original.
Por medio de la transacción WE81 se definen los tipos de mensajes con su descripción. Para ello, accedemos a la transacción y presionamos el botón Entrada nuevas. Un mensaje es solamente un nombre y su descripción, luego de estar definido, deben asignarse los tipos de bases y las formas de procesos posibles.
la asignación del tipo de mensaje con el tipo de base correspondientes, se realiza a través de la transacción WE82.
A través de transacción WE57 se asigna el módulo de función que procesara el IDOC, con el tipo base y el tipo de mensaje y se indica si este módulo de funciones es de entrada o salida.
Para acceder a la documentación de un IDOC existen, se utiliza la transacción WE60. Con esta transacción, además, se puede agregar documentación a un tipo base Z o Ampliación.
Otras transacciones de documentación de IDOCS son:
- WE61 - Tipo de registro de IDOCS.
- WE62 - Segmento de IDOCS.
- WE64 - Código de proceso.
 
 
 
Sobre el autor
Publicación académica de Javier Miguel Angel Barcelo, en su ámbito de estudios para la Carrera Consultor ABAP.
Javier Miguel Angel Barcelo
Profesión: Militar - Argentina - Legajo: DQ34X
✒️Autor de: 107 Publicaciones Académicas
🎓Egresado del módulo:
Disponibilidad Laboral: PartTime
Certificación Académica de Javier Angel